Abstract
A crude oil sample bucket cleaner comprises an electric control disc, a cabinet cover, an impact switch, a cabinet body, a cleaning barrel, a recovery box, an oil recovery duct, a return pipe, an electric heating pipe, a temperature sensor, a motor, a water pump, a water diversion head, a stop valve, a sprinkler bead and a cabinet body door, of which the cabinet body is a rectangle, and the top part is provided with a cabinet cover; a rectangle cleaning barrel is arranged on the upper part in the cabinet body, a recovery box is arranged on the middle part and a motor, a water pump and a water diversion head are arranged on the lower part in the cabinet body; a cabinet body door is positioned in the front; the electric control disc is arranged on the middle upper part of the cabinet body door; a power source impact switch is arranged between the cabinet cover and the upper end face of the cabinet body; a communicating pipe communicated with the recovery box is positioned below the cleaning barrel; seven nozzles are arranged around the cleaning barrel; a return pipe vertically extended into the box and communicated with the inlet of the water pump is arranged in middle at the bottom of the recovery box; seven outlet water diversion heads are positioned on the outlet pipe of the water pump; the seven outlets are connected with the seven sprinkler beads through flexible pipes; the start and stop of the water pump are controlled through a power source switch and an impact switch.

One, technical field
The utility model relates to a kind of crude oil sampling barrel cleaner of oil in test of crude analysis usefulness.
Two, background technology
It all is artificial cleaning that the bucket of crude oil sampling at present cleans, and with hairbrush and gasoline the sampling bucket is gone up thick crude oil washing/COW and falls, and cleans several all over just crude oil washing/COW being fallen, waste time and energy waste gasoline, and contaminated environment, influence lab technician's physical and mental health, the waste oil that has cleaned badly also can cause fire as handling.
Three, summary of the invention
The purpose of this utility model provides a kind of crude oil sampling barrel cleaner, overcomes the drawback that wastes time and energy, wastes gasoline, contaminated environment, easy breaking out of fire that artificial cleaning sampling bucket brings.
The technical solution of the utility model realizes in the following manner:
The utility model is made up of electric control panel, cabinet lid, impact switch, cabinet, washing bucket, collection box, collection tube, return pipe, electrothermal tube, temperature sensor, motor, water pump, water diversing head, stop valve, fountain head and cabinet body door, it is characterized in that cabinet is made as rectangle, be provided with the cabinet lid at its top, top is provided with the rectangle washing bucket within it, the middle part is provided with collection box within it, the bottom is provided with motor, water pump and water diversing head within it, is provided with cabinet body door in its front; The middle part is provided with electric control panel on cabinet body door; Between cabinet lid and cabinet upper surface, be provided with the power supply impact switch; The washing bucket bottom is provided with the communicating pipe that is communicated with collection box; The all sides of washing bucket are provided with 7 nozzles; Establish in the middle part of at the bottom of the collection box and vertically stretch in the case and return pipe that be communicated with the water pump import, pump outlet tube is provided with the water diversing head of 7 outlets, and 7 outlets are connected with 7 fountain heads by flexible pipe; The water pump start and stop are by power switch and impact switch control.
Be provided with 2-3 root electrothermal tube and a temperature sensor in all sides middle and lower part of collection box, collection box week upper lateral part establish contact-making switch, and cooperate with projection in the ball float rotating shaft.
Be provided with an oily swash plate of retaining at collection box internal upper part to middle part, be provided with oblique centrosymmetric two blocks of sand block plates at the collection box middle part; Bottom side at recovery tank is provided with sand removing hole.
On electric control panel, be provided with power switch, power supply indicator, work liquid level indicator lamp, low liquid level indicator lamp, start button and thermometer.
The utility model heats by electrothermal tube, by temperature sensor control temperature, start and stop by Floating Ball Liquid Level Control and impact switch control water pump, realized control automatically in the cleaning sample bucket process, alleviated chemical examination worker's work load, prevent environmental pollution, saved gasoline and water, guaranteed to clean the safety of sample bucket.

Five, the specific embodiment
For further disclosing the technical solution of the utility model, elaborate by embodiment below in conjunction with Figure of description:
The utility model is by electric control panel 1, cabinet lid 2, impact switch 3, cabinet 4, washing bucket 5, collection box 6, electrothermal tube 7, return duct 8, temperature sensor 9, sand block plate 10, motor 11, water pump 12, water diversing head 13, communicating pipe 14, oil-out 15, floating-ball level switch 16, shower nozzle 17, cabinet body door 18, water inlet pipe 19 and oil baffle 20 are formed, it is characterized in that cabinet is made as rectangle, be provided with cabinet lid 2 at its top, top is provided with rectangle washing bucket 5 within it, inside is provided with collection box 6 therein, the bottom is provided with motor 11 within it, water pump 12 and water diversing head 13 are provided with cabinet body door 18 in its front; The middle part is provided with electric control panel 1 on cabinet body door; Between cabinet lid 2 and cabinet 4 upper surfaces, be provided with power supply impact switch 3; The washing bucket bottom is provided with the communicating pipe 14 that is communicated with collection box; The all sides of washing bucket are provided with 7 nozzles 17; Establish in the middle part of at the bottom of the collection box and vertically stretch in the case and return duct 8 that be communicated with the water pump import, 13,7 outlets of water diversing head that pump outlet tube is provided with 7 outlets are connected with 7 fountain heads by flexible pipe; The water pump start and stop are by power switch and impact switch control.
The utility model is when using, at first put water into from water inlet pipe 19, turn on the power switch, power supply indicator is bright, give for electrothermal tube 7, temperature sensor 9 is defeated by thermometer with temperature signal by master control borad, when temperature to 50 degree is above, press start button, motor 11 rotates and drives water pump 12, hot water in the recovery tank 6 is sprayed on by water diversing head 13 and shower nozzle 17 that the sampling bucket is gone up or bucket in, crude oil on the bucket is washed off, crude oil and water or sand are from enter collection box 6 communicating pipe 14 of washing bucket 5, earlier through oil baffle 20, crude oil is last, and water sand descends along oil baffle 20, and stream is on sand block plate 10, sand descends along the sand block plate, enter at the bottom of the case, with increasing of crude oil or sand, floating-ball level switch 16 action crude exports 15 motor-driven valves are opened and are drained the oil, oil enters the stall of crude oil storage tank motor, when low liquid level indicator lamp was bright, water inlet pipe 19 motor-driven valves were opened supplementing water, when liquid level arrives working solution, motor rotation, continue to clean the sampling bucket,, open cabinet lid 2 when washing sample bucket sample bucket wash clean after 5 minutes, impact switch 3 is turned off motor, cleaning machine once can be washed 5-10 bucket, puts sand one time every certain hour, makes sandstone can not be higher than sand block plate 10.
